可以安装/转换Android应用程序在iPhone上运行吗?

时间:2011-05-06 22:36:11

标签: iphone android

我有一个针对Android 2.2(在Eclipse中开发)的android项目。将android项目导出到Droid Incredible非常有效。是否可以将项目导出到适合在iphone上安装的文件?我知道大多数iPhone应用程序是使用xCode开发的,但我不确定xCode是否打包成.apk或其他等效的文件格式。

提前致谢。

3 个答案:

答案 0 :(得分:1)

只有您编写或移植自己的完整Dalvik VM(使用Objective C或Javascript),并且开发应用程序使用的任何和所有API调用所需的运行时支持,并将所有这些调用与您的应用程序捆绑在一起,就像那样是在iPhone上运行常规Android项目的唯一方法。

非常重要的工作量。

在Objective C和Cocoa Touch中完全重写应用程序会更容易。

答案 1 :(得分:0)

甚至无法远程实现。 Android和iOS是完全不同的环境。有一些框架可用于开发可运行的应用程序,但结果往往在两个平台上看起来都很奇怪。

答案 2 :(得分:0)

您无法导出Android应用程序并在iPhone中运行它,因为硬件/软件堆栈/ API /等。是不同的。

但是,如果使用例如PhoneGap(基于HTML5的应用程序框架)构建应用程序,则可以将其部署在不同的移动平台上。

如果您对多平台移动框架(Android / iPhone)感到好奇,您可能会发现这个thread很有趣。